Senator Mary Landrieu, a U.S. senator who represents Louisiana, is up for reelection this year and it looks like it’ll be a tight race. She’s a Democrat seeking a fourth term, and her reelection is certainly far from assured. In order to get the word out about her campaign, she attended an LSU tailgate this weekend. That’s not a bad idea when you think about it. It’s a great way to reach out to voters, both young and old. While at the tailgate, Senator Landrieu got pretty heavily involved in the festivities for a politician.
Numerous bystanders snapped photos of Senator Landrieu helping an LSU student do a keg stand. She’s literally holding the guy’s mouth. When asked about the incident, Landrieu responded that the drinker’s “father was there, so I felt OK about it.”
People in the crowd even tried to get Landrieu to do a keg stand herself, but, as you probably expected, she declined. Naturally, she thought it might look bad for the press, but you never know.
